Why Upgrade Your House Locks?
There are numerous factors why property owners might consider updating their locks, consisting of:
- Increased Security: Older locks may be much easier to bypass, as they might not satisfy modern security standards.
- Lost Keys: If secrets have been lost, it is smart to upgrade locks to prevent unapproved gain access to.
- Moving into a New Home: New homeowners typically do not know the number of copies of the house secrets exist and ought to alter locks for safety.
- Insurance Requirements: Home insurance plan might require specific lock types to be in place for complete protection.
- Technological Advancements: Smart locks offer increased performance and gain access to control, such as mobile app control and remote monitoring.
Kinds of Locks
When considering a lock upgrade, homeowners have numerous options. Below is a table comparing various types of locks:
| Lock Type | Description |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|---|
| Deadbolts | A Bolt that can only be run by a key or thumb turn. | High security; hard to select. | Needs drilling; lower visual appeals. |
| Smart Locks | Electronic locks that can be managed through smartphones. | Remote access; tracking; convenience. | Reliance on power; threat of hacking. |
| Lever Handle Locks | Common in industrial settings; run by a lever. | Easy to use for any ages. | Less protected than deadbolts. |
| Mortise Locks | Complex lock systems installed within a pocket in the door. | Strong security; hard to control. | Tough installation; costly. |
| Keyless Entry | Needs a keycode to unlock without a key. | No keys required; easy access control. | Codes should be changed routinely for security. |

Installation Process
The installation procedure can differ depending upon the type of lock chosen. Here are basic steps for upgrading your house locks:
- Select Your Lock: Choose the kind of lock that meets your needs.
- Remove Old Locks: Unscrew and secure the old lock from the door.
- Prepare the Door: Ensure any holes are totally free of debris and effectively sized for the brand-new locks.
- Set Up New Locks: Follow the maker's directions to set up the brand-new lock safe in place.
- Test Functionality: Ensure that the lock operates properly, both from the exterior and interior.
- Re-key if Necessary: For locks that need a key, think about having them re-keyed if you have old secrets.
